For the PX, they show up on Ebay on occasion. BUT beware. I have bought several off of there and about half have undisclosed problems with the volume knobs, missing the removable IC's, missing cable (early round cable) , ect...I will let you know if I come across one.
My suggestion is to buy a 2nd gen PX. The one with the phone type cable. A lot less problems with it. If you ever need info on the Zapco's, PM me. (or Tim) ...
